摘要
Graphitic carbon nitride (g-C3N4) stands as a prominent and sustainable photocatalyst, offering a transformative solution to pressing environmental and energy challenges. This review article provides a comprehensive examination of g-C3N4, spanning its synthesis methods, structural properties, photocatalytic mechanisms, and diverse applications. By delving into various synthesis techniques and their respective merits, we reveal recent breakthroughs that underscore the material's growing significance. Unveiling the critical structural attributes governing photocatalytic performance, including bandgap, surface area, and porosity, we explore the impact of doping and modification on enhancing its capabilities. In elucidating the photocatalytic mechanisms, we showcase how g-C3N4 facilitates crucial processes like water splitting, pollutant degradation, and solar-driven carbon dioxide reduction, emphasizing its unique selectivity and efficiency. Through concrete examples and case studies, we highlight its versatility in applications ranging from water purification to hydrogen production and air quality enhancement, underscoring the environmental and economic benefits that come with its adoption. Challenges such as quantum efficiency and charge carrier recombination are addressed, alongside a forward-looking perspective on emerging trends and innovations. Ultimately, this review positions g-C3N4 as a sustainable game-changer in the realm of environmental and energy technologies, offering a promising path towards a more sustainable future.
